On the same beaches, but at the other end of the economic spectrum, Gazaâs fishermen gather to pull what sustenance they can from the sea. I join Ayman Alamodi, a father of four who began his fishing career three decades ago, for a dayâs journey on the water following a ceasefire after weeks of relentless Israeli air strikes and naval shelling along Gazaâs coast.
His boat, stagnant in the water for so long, bears the wear and tear of neglect, with faded paint and parts of the deck showing signs of rot. The meticulously woven fishing nets, crafted by Aymanâs weathered hands, hang limp and lifeless, burdened by silt and debris. Nevertheless, he races to catch whatever fish he can before sunset or a breach of the ceasefire.
Sharing a boat with nine other relatives, including his 34-year-old nephew Mouneer, poses a challenge as they collectively sustain seventy family members. All eyes are fixed on them, hoping they will return with enough food.
But after a few hours at sea, the fish we caught hardly cover the cost of the fuel used to run the boatâs motor. Ayman and Mouneer clear the fishing nets of crabs and proceed with the small sardines. On his way back to Al Shati refugee camp, Ayman avoids passing in front of the gas station, knowing he canât settle his fuel debt this time. However, he remains hopeful tomorrow will be better.
Palestinian fishermen suffered severe losses when Israeli F-16s repeatedly struck sheds storing fishing equipment. Amjad Shrafi, deputy head of the Gaza Fishermenâs Syndicate, tells me that in one month of bombardment, Israeli shelling cost the fishing industry about $3 million in damage to fishing gear alone. The Israeli navy also regularly confiscates fishing boats on the thinnest of pretenses.
Sadly, the loss does not end with money and equipment. Itâs common for Israeli navy ships to fire on Gaza fishermen without provocation, or for approaching the arbitrary three-nautical-mile limit imposed by Israel. Occasionally, Israel âgenerouslyâ grants access to six nautical miles. Under the Oslo Accords, Palestinians should be granted access to twenty nautical miles off the Gaza coast, but this almost never happens in practice. Ayman knows all the names of his fellow fishermen who have been arrested, injured, or killed while fishing. The list is long, and some are his own relatives.
As a result of Israelâs theft, violence, destruction, and restrictions, about 95% of Gazaâs fishermen live in poverty.14
âItâs honestly a waste of time,â Ayman says. âThere are no fish within three miles now. Further out, beyond six miles, there are natural stones where we can find a variety of delicious and nourishing fish.â His hands, roughened by the elements, expertly moor his fishing boat to the harbor with twists and turns of the rope. As the sun prepares to set, I donât envy the plight of the seventy souls dependent on this boat for their lives. Another day will dawn promising nothing more than bread and tea. Even securing them all a morsel of fish to eat is not assured in such a limited, fished-out zone.
